Verify Credentials and Licenses

Before hiring a contractor, it's essential to verify their credentials and licenses. In Washington, contractors must be registered with the state and carry the necessary licenses to perform remodeling work. Check with the Washington State Department of Labor & Industries to confirm that the contractor is licensed and in good standing. Additionally, ensure that they have the appropriate insurance coverage, including liability and workers' compensation, to protect both you and their workers in case of accidents or damages.

Request Detailed Estimates

Once you have a shortlist of potential contractors, request detailed estimates for your project. A comprehensive estimate should include a breakdown of costs for materials, labor, and any additional expenses. Be wary of estimates that seem unusually low, as they may indicate subpar materials or hidden costs. Comparing estimates from multiple contractors can help you identify a fair price range for your project and ensure that you’re getting the best value for your investment.

Review Contracts Carefully

Before signing a contract, review it carefully to ensure that all terms and conditions are clearly outlined. The contract should include details such as the scope of work, timeline, payment schedule, and warranty information. Make sure that any verbal agreements made during negotiations are included in the written contract. If you have any questions or concerns, address them with the contractor before signing. A well-drafted contract can protect both parties and serve as a reference point throughout the project.

Consider Local Knowledge

Choosing a contractor with local knowledge can be advantageous for your remodeling project. A contractor familiar with Bothell will have a better understanding of local building codes, permit requirements, and suppliers. This can help streamline the renovation process and ensure compliance with all regulations. Additionally, a local contractor may have established relationships with local suppliers and subcontractors, which can lead to cost savings and timely completion of your project.
